WebbShould I Remove Yellow Leaves from My Squash Plants? No. Removing yellow squash leaves tends to open a vascular system for bacteria and virus entry. It increases the risk of killing the squash plants. The best option is to allow the yellow leaves to wither and drop off from the plant. Do not prune your squash plants at all. WebbSquash leaves are best used immediately, as they are prone to wilting when stored. Some home cooks recommend immersing the Squash leaves in a container of water, then placing the container in a plastic bag before refrigeration.
